Output 26ed06a87cc470f4e03d94973b7840f959ed3878df40e925fd8f268c5564a1af:1

value
19818
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85f6b9e5426e70b29d0095a3fcb419c6413ba616 OP_EQUAL
address
3DuMMtdPzhn9mkdV1g6yMXQeUZQjGVE5ag
transaction
26ed06a87cc470f4e03d94973b7840f959ed3878df40e925fd8f268c5564a1af